Butter Ponzu Grilled Salmon
Cook Time:
15mins
Calories:
Approximately361kcal
*for one serving
*The calorific values are calculated based on the Standard Tables of Food Composition in Japan.
Ingredients
serves2
Salmon | 2 fillets |
|---|---|
Salt | a pinch |
Coarsely Ground Black Pepper | a pinch |
Vegetable Oil (for frying) | 1 tablespoon |
Butter | 10g |
3 tablespoons | |
Potato | 1/2 medium |
Baby Leaf Salad | as needed |
Directions
- 1.Sprinkle both sides of the salmon with salt and coarsely ground black pepper. Let it sit for about 10 minutes to season.
- 2.Wash the potato thoroughly with water, wrap it in a damp paper towel, and then cover it with cling film. Microwave on 600W for 2 minutes. Test by inserting a toothpick; if it goes through easily, it’s done. If it’s still firm, microwave for an additional minute.
- 3. Heat vegetable oil in a frying pan and cook the salmon on both sides until golden brown and cooked through. Once cooked, use a paper towel to wipe off any excess oil from the pan.
- 4.Add the butter and Ajipon® Citrus Seasoned Soy Sauce to the pan, and quickly stir-fry to coat the salmon evenly. Serve on a plate with the potato (cut into wedges) and baby leaf salad on the side.
